Germany closes embassy in South Sudan due to looming civil war

  • Germany has temporarily closed its embassy in South Sudan due to the country being on the brink of civil war, as stated by German Foreign Minister Annalena Baerbock.
  • Baerbock announced the decision while emphasizing that the safety of employees is a top priority.
  • Baerbock criticized South Sudan President Salva Kiir and Vice President Riek Machar for their roles in escalating violence.
  • She urged both leaders to stop the violence and implement the peace agreement.
